Power: 235, Max Speed: 63, Price: 165,000. All parts have been adapted for FS25 using Blender. Color options are functional, and the exhaust option is included, along with rain droplets. The interior cabin features a few small details. I am aware of some mistakes and will address them in due time. Note: I am unable to run the icon generator application for FS25, so the images are not new; they will be updated in the second release. Features include JCB CX3 and JCB CX4 models, crab walk mode, and the ability to toggle turning collision on and off with the X key. The right and left doors, as well as the rear window, open with animation, controlled by group 3. The rear arm can extend and retract, and you can lower the rear support legs to your desired level. When the front bucket is opened, it empties if there is material inside; if closed, it empties normally. There is also an option for forklift forks and front bucket tines.
